This is normal behaviour. If part of a query is not understood, SMW will run
the query anyway with the remaining conditions. In this case, there are no
conditions, and all pages (including the historical ones of Bug 18406) are
returned. However, I agree that it makes sense to stop query processing in any
case if there are errors and no valid conditions were found. This is
implemented now in r111255.

In general, you can set $smwgIgnoreQueryErrors = false in LocalSettings to make
SMW stop query answering when errors are found (whether or not the query is
empty).
